Harry Potter: The Prequel is Book Number 0.5 in the Series Harry Potter
"Harry Potter: The Prequel" is not a full-length book but rather an 800-word short story written by J.K. Rowling in 2008 for a charity auction organized by Waterstones to benefit English PEN and the Dyslexia Society. Set approximately three years before the birth of Harry Potter, around 1977, it offers a brief glimpse into the lives of two beloved characters from the Harry Potter series: Sirius Black and James Potter, Harry’s father, during their teenage years.
The story follows Sirius and James, who are riding a magical motorcycle at high speed, leading to a chase by two Muggle (non-magical) policemen, PC Anderson and Sergeant Fisher, into a dead-end alley. As the officers confront the pair, three additional figures on broomsticks swoop in, escalating the situation. Using their wands, Sirius and James magically upend the police car and cause the broomstick riders to crash into it, knocking them out. The two young wizards then escape on the motorcycle, leaving the bewildered policemen behind. The tale captures their youthful rebellion, quick thinking, and flair for magic, ending with Rowling’s handwritten note: "From the prequel I am NOT working on – but that was fun!" This lighthearted adventure highlights the daring camaraderie between Sirius and James before the darker events of the Harry Potter saga unfold.
